Thrawn5:First of all DO NOT BLOW UP THE STAIRS!!! This is a very dangerous method as you can light your house on fire or not get the job done properly.
Here is what I suggest you do:
Get a sledghammer/axe/maul or anything that is large, heavy, and controllable, start attacking your stairs from the bottom (after devising a way to get back to the top after you are done). You want to make sure that NONE of the staircase is left standing, if you cant get bach up the staircase without the method that you set up earlier you should be good (as long as you are in good shape). If at all possible, raze the stairs compleatly.
Richboy33lb- As Max Brooks says, do NOT try to burn or blow up your stairs. You will likely just burn down your fortress. Take an axe or sledgehammer, as they work best, and walk up the stairs backwards, destroying the stairs in gradual steps. Make sure you have a ladder ready to get back downstairs and all of your supplies get upstairs. Also, have an escape route, such as window that leads you to a section of your roof.

To destroy (de-construct) the average staircase in a modern home isn't that difficult to do. All you need is a razor knife, prybar, crowbar and heavy weight hammer.
First you cut up and remove the carpeting from the staircase's treads, then set the prybar under the tread and hit it with the hammer to drive (wedge) the prybar between the riser and the tread. Once the gap is large enough, set the prybar in the gap and using the crowbars extra leverage, lift the tread off the riser. Repeat as needed, until all treads have been removed. If desired you could then dismantled the risers, but I'm not sure that would be required, as I doubt zed's are co-ordinated enough to climb the risers to the second floor. For safety and security after I removed the risers I'd construct a simple solid wall out of plywood and be done with it. |
